(UPDATE) MANILA, Philippines — President Ferdinand Marcos Jr. directed the Department of Health (DoH) and other pertinent government agencies to stay vigilant in monitoring mpox, formerly monkeypox, Malacanang said on Wednesday, following reports that 41 people were quarantined after coming into contact with an individual infected with the disease, the first such case in the Philippines.
The Chief Executive gave the order during his meeting with Health Secretary Teodoro Herbosa and other officials last Tuesday, according to the Presidential Communications Office (PCO).
